Product Introduction

Overview

The SN74LV595ADR is a high-performance, 8-bit shift register with output latches, manufactured by Texas Instruments. This IC is designed for applications requiring serial-to-parallel data conversion, making it a versatile component in digital systems. It is part of the LV (Low-Voltage) family, ensuring compatibility with low-voltage systems while maintaining robust performance. The SN74LV595ADR is widely used in applications such as LED displays, data storage, and general-purpose logic expansion. Its compact SOIC-16 package and low power consumption make it suitable for portable and space-constrained designs.

Key Features

  • Low-Voltage Operation: Supports supply voltages from 2 V to 5.5 V, making it ideal for battery-powered and low-power applications.
  • High-Speed Performance: Features a propagation delay of 11 ns (typical) at 5 V, ensuring efficient data transfer.
  • Output Latches: Includes 8-bit output latches for stable data retention during shifting operations.
  • Compact Package: Available in a space-saving SOIC-16 package, suitable for modern PCB designs.
  • High Drive Capability: Can source or sink up to 6 mA per output, enabling direct drive of LEDs and other loads.

Applications

The SN74LV595ADR is widely used in various digital systems, including:

  • LED Displays: Drives multiple LEDs in matrix or segment displays, simplifying control circuitry.
  • Data Storage: Acts as a buffer or temporary storage for serial data in microcontroller-based systems.
  • Logic Expansion: Extends the number of output pins in microcontrollers or other logic devices.
  • Industrial Automation: Used in control systems for signal distribution and data handling.
  • Consumer Electronics: Found in devices such as remote controls, gaming consoles, and home appliances.
